a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--Makefile.release9
1 files changed, 4 insertions, 5 deletions
diff --git a/Makefile.release b/Makefile.release
index 6d863e211..129b0da17 100644
--- a/Makefile.release
+++ b/Makefile.release
@@ -47,6 +47,9 @@ COMMA:=$(EMPTY),$(EMPTY)
ifeq (, $(shell which curl))
$(error "No curl in $$PATH, please install")
endif
+ifeq (, $(shell which manifest-tool))
+ $(error "No manifest-tool in $$PATH, please install")
+endif
DOCKER:=
NAME:=coredns
@@ -60,14 +63,10 @@ PLATFORMS:=$(subst $(SPACE),$(COMMA),$(foreach arch,$(LINUX_ARCH),linux/$(arch))
all:
@echo Use the 'release' target to build a release, 'docker' for docker build.
-release: pre build tar
+release: build tar
docker: docker-build
-.PHONY: pre
-pre:
- GO111MODULE=off go get github.com/estesp/manifest-tool
-
.PHONY: build
build:
@echo Cleaning old builds